1. Having An All-Or-Nothing Mindset

People who have this all-or-nothing kind of attitude demand that they abide by their diet plan right down to the smallest of details. Sadly, if for whatever reason they are unable to adhere to the diet, they just discontinue it. For these kind of people, it is better to just drop everything all together.

If you have this kind of attitude, you need to understand that mistakes are normal. You just need to be flexible and make any necessary changes so you can go back on track and continue with your weight loss plan.

2. The Wrong Meaning Of Sacrifice

One other mistake commonly made is to look at your diet as a “sacrifice” which is very negative. With this attitude, you feel that you need to make a huge sacrifice in order to achieve your dieting goal.

This attitude is wrong because what happens when you’ve attained your goal? When your so-called sacrifice ends, will you feel entitled to a huge reward for having gone through all that “suffering”? Will you reward yourself with lots of junk food that you couldn’t have during your act of sacrifice?

You need to stop viewing dieting as a huge sacrifice. Rather, look at it as a wonderful life style change that will improve your health in lots of ways.

3. Setting The Wrong Goals

Another big mistake that eager dieters make is setting goals that just cannot be attained. You should set goals that are based on reality. And the reality is, losing 2kg a week is more attainable than losing 20kg in a mere 2 weeks. Therefore, don’t decide on a goal that has a high probably of failing.

Do Natural Remedies for Acid Reflux Really Work?

Many people are skeptical of natural remedies for acid reflux, thinking that there is no way they could work as effectively as the more conventional treatment methods that are available. This is actually a myth, and in fact, some of the natural remedies for acid reflux that are available have proven to be better than more conventional methods.

Ideas

There are some great ideas that you can choose to go with when it comes to natural remedies for acid reflux.

There are many advantages that you will receive by choosing to use natural remedies for acid reflux, including that you will not have to deal with the unfavorable and unwanted side effects that you would with other options.

A few of the best natural remedies for acid reflux include chamomile, meadowsweet, slippery elm, cancer bush, fennel, catnip, angelica root, ginger root, and aloe. Chamomile helps by relieving irritation in the esophagus, and is thought to have calming and relaxing properties. It also has the ability to reduce the amount of stomach acid and promote normal digestion.

Next to chamomile, slippery elm is the most popular of all natural remedies for acid reflux. It is such a specific remedy for helping acid reflux and similar conditions that it is really too bad doctors and hospitals do not prescribe it more.

One of the most favorable qualities of slippery elm is how quickly it works, and acid reflux sufferers can feel relief almost immediately. It is also a very safe herb so you do not have to worry as much about overuse.

Tips

There are a few things that you should keep in mind if you plan to use any natural or home remedies for your acid reflux. More than anything you need to realize that just because these herbs are helping relieve the pain you will still need to take other steps including making changes in your lifestyle in order to find a long term solution.

It is important that you eat a healthy, well balanced diet and get plenty of exercise if you want to have permanent relief of your acid reflux, and also stay away from foods that will aggravate your condition, such as tomatoes, mashed potatoes, French fries, ground beef, sour cream, cottage cheese, macaroni and cheese, spaghetti, ice cream, and eggs. Also keep in mind that although herbal remedies are generally safe they are still a form of medicine and so you need to use common sense when starting on any of them.

Vegetables are a great way to provide the necessary vitamins and minerals to your family. However, how many times have you told your children to eat their vegetables? Probably a lot.

Most children seem to have an aversion to vegetables. They will push them around their plate, refuse to eat them and cry. Whether you are trying out vegetable soup recipes or good vegetable grill recipes, children know when you have sneaked healthy vegetables into their meal, and they will probably kick up a fuss.

Vegetables do not always have to be the enemy. The key is to find a creative way to prepare them and your family will become vegetable lovers rather than vegetable haters!

When you stop and think about it, when you were a child and your mother dropped a droopy, soggy, green hunk of broccoli on your plate, would you eat it? Probably not.

There are ways to get your children to eat vegetables without going crazy doing it. Broccoli is one vegetable that is highest in vitamins and minerals, and there are many different ways to prepare it.

Try it raw. Leave a plate of raw broccoli in bite-size pieces in the refrigerator for your children as a snack. Offer some salad dressing so they can dip it and this is often a hit. Leave the tips of the broccoli on the plate and encourage your child to eat them. You can even make a creative game of this. Grilled vegetable recipes are not the only way to serve healthy vegetables.

Bribery - Do not laugh, it works! Tell your child that if he or she eats their veggies, you will give them a special treat when they are done. It is important that you follow through and give him or her the treat.

Cheese - cheese and broccoli go together excellently. Adding a cheesy sauce changes the flavor and texture of the broccoli and your children might even prefer the cheesy broccoli to whatever else is on their plate. You can use cheese in vegetable soup recipes. This also works with good vegetable grill recipes. Most kids love a cheesy flavor.

Lasagna - add broccoli to lasagna and smother it with sauce and cheese. Your children may not notice that it is there, and if they do, they will find it to be delicious.

Chop it up - if all else fails, pre cook the broccoli and let it cool a little and put it in a food processor. Chop it up until it is not recognizable and add it to whatever dish you are cooking. Your children will not even know it is there.

This might sound strange but it works. Make your kids a milkshake with milk, ice cream, and chocolate syrup. Add some broccoli to the shake and blend it. Your kids will not be able to see or taste the broccoli as long as the ice cream is chunky.

Vegetables are high in essential nutrients, especially for growing kids, so it is great that there are so many ways to get them to eat their veggies!

Conjugated Linoleic Acid And How It Helps You Lose Weight

By Ann Huz | August 13, 2008

by Ann Huz

Conjugated linoleic acid (or CLA) is a substance that is contained in many kinds of food. Studies that have been conducted on it show that CLA reduces fat while at the same increases muscle mass. Participants taking CLA as a supplement lost fat even without making any changes in either their diet or physical activities.

Bodybuilders commonly use CLA to lose weight whilst building up muscle mass. Nevertheless, it can be helpful for any individual who’s overweight since having more muscle increases the rate of metabolism which burns even more calories.

Combined with a well-nourished diet, conjugated linoleic acid can bring about weight loss. Experts in weight loss generally agree that the best diet is the so-called non-diet. This means that you just have smaller portions of a normal but well-balanced diet rather than limiting yourself to consuming just a few types of food and totally ignoring others. So you could still have fries and pizza, but just in smaller portions and not all the time.

If that kind of diet appeals to you, then CLA can aid in reinforcing your weight loss by giving a boost to your fat loss. Understand that CLA will not make a fat cell become little. Rather, it keeps the fat cells from getting bigger.

Research relating to CLA was published in The Journal of Nutrition. It showed that those taking CLA lost more body fat in comparison with people that had only taken a placebo. In fact, on average, they had lost 6 lbs more.

Researchers estimated that an individual needs a daily amount of 3.4 grams in order for CLA to be truly effective. As stated above, CLA is naturally found in foods such as dairy products and meat but to reach that daily level, supplementation may be necessary.

A further study showed that CLA even had an effect on insulin levels in diabetics. Furthermore, it brought down their triglyceride and blood glucose levels. This indicates that CLA could also aid in sustaining normal insulin levels.

There are currently no magic pills in existence for weight loss and CLA certainly should not be construed as being one, but if you truly want to reduce your body fat, it may help you. When taken with a healthy diet, conjugated linoleic acid may help you towards your ideal weight.

Pilates is not only a work out method it is a way to control your mind, body and spirit. The use of focused breathing and attention paid to the muscle groups builds the ability to focus the mind away from problems. Many people find themselves ill due to stress and lack of exercise. Pilates answers both of these problems.

The Pilates exercise regimen unites your body and mind and also gives you discipline. All these will have positive benefits to your health and well being. Stress brings many chemical changes to your body. It increases blood flow to the larger muscles and slows digestion as it prepares the body for “fight or flight” mode. Your blood vessels restrict and sugar rises. Many hormones are switched into off position. If this were primitive times and there was real danger than this would be a good thing. However much of todays stress has more to do with day to day living such as problems at work or debt piling up.

Many people end up in the hospital from stress related diseases. Stress wreaks havoc on your immune system as it slows healing and most of all prevents wellness. Wellness is not the opposite of illness. It is more than just the lack of sickness; it is an overall well-being that affects both the mental and the physical aspects of life. Many adverse habits develop because of stress and lack of wellness.

Doing Pilates can actually help break the cycle of worry and anxiety. Much like any mental exercise that allows the individual more control of thought patterns, Pilates offers a way to change your focus and relieve the stress.

The exercise from Pilates releases the body from the flight or fight mode by mimicking the activity of both. Exercise is a proven method of stress control, when combined with the activity of mental control and focus on breathing, the quick return of stress is unlikely and the cycle is broken for that period.

Studies link a reduction of disease with exercise. A study at the University of Calgary and the University of Ottowa showed a decrease in blood sugar when type two diabetics exercised. The decrease translated into a reduction of heart attack and diabetic kidney and eye disease. Other studies show a reduction of 40 percent in mortality rate for diabetics. Lack of activity is one of the biggest risk factors in heart disease. Overweight is another. Pilates reduces both risks and is a heart healthy activity. Stress is also linked to tumor growth in cancer victims. While there is no study that shows psychological stress creates cancer, there are many that shows it impairs the immune system and creates an environment conducive to cancer.
